Solomon Demeter Synonyms
We can't find synonyms for the phrase "Solomon Demeter", but we have synonyms for terms, you can combine them.SD abbreviation
SD is an abbreviation for Solomon DemeterWhat does SD stand for?
SD stands for "Solomon Demeter" Definitions for Solomon
Definitions for Demeter
- (noun) (Greek mythology) goddess of fertility and protector of marriage in ancient mythology; counterpart of Roman Ceres